 Late-ripening cabbage TARAS F1

High yielding, excellent storage and eating quality


 

Taras F1 - Late ripening hybrid. The period from transplanting to harvesting is 130-145 days. Flat round-shaped heads with a small cone near core have a very high density, inner core isn't big. Average head's weight is between 2,5-4 kg. Thrips and lice can't produce damage to plants thanks to strong vegetable wax. Spreading plant has a tall stem that shows excellent storage quality. Hybrid has a resistance to many diseases (fusarium blight, alternaria blight, stem blight, black rot and stump rot of cabbage) and usually doesn't affected by focal necrosis during storage. Hybrid is all-purpose, can be used for pickling after a long storage (8-10 month). It is recommended to plant by using 30-40 days seedlings and the follow scheme 70 x 45-50 cm. The recommended nutrient soil balance for receiving 80-100 tons per hectare is the follow: N 200-250 kg/h; P2O5 75-100 kg/h; K2O 250-350 kg/ha.
